Pro wrestling can be very unpredictable and you never know when something can go wrong. It seems as though LAX member Santana suffered some sort of knee injury during Slammiversary.

Santana went down during his triple threat Impact Wrestling Tag Team Championship match. He was holding his left knee the entire time and didn’t get back in the match after Konnan brought attention to him by throwing up the dreaded X.

After the match was over, Don Callis got off of commentary and walked over to help Santana up so he walked out with assistance.

Let’s hope that he’s okay, but that wasn’t the best news to get for sure especially because he just recovered from an MCL injury.
